Applies to:
SQL Server
Azure SQL Managed Instance
Returns the number of network packet errors that have occurred on SQL Server connections since SQL Server was last started.
Transact-SQL syntax conventions
@@PACKET_ERRORS
integer
To display a report containing several SQL Server statistics, including packet errors, run sp_monitor.
The following example shows using @@PACKET_ERRORS
.
SELECT @@PACKET_ERRORS AS 'Packet Errors';
Here is a sample result set.
Packet Errors
-------------
0
